Public/Applied History is the 828th most popular major in the country with 229 degrees awarded in 2020-2021.

Across the New England region, there were 17 public/applied history gra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ively.

This ranking identifies schools with high-quality public/applied history programs that also have a lower cost than schools of similar quality.

To come up with these rankings, we looked at factors such as the cost to attend the school after aid is awarded and overall quality of the public/applied history program at the school. See our ranking methodology to learn more.

Out of the 1 schools in the Best Value Public/Applied History Schools in the New England Region For Those Making $75-$110k that were part of this year’s ranking, Salem State University landed the #1 spot on the list. Salem, Massachusetts is the setting for this medium-sized institution of higher learning. The public school handed out ’s public/applied history degrees to 12 students in 2020-2021.

Salem State also made our “Best Public/Applied History Schools in the New England Region” list, coming in at #1. It costs about $21,401 for new england region public/applied history students whose families make $75-$110k per year to attend Salem State University.
